Pembroke and Roccalumera, a town in Sicily, are planning to enter a twinning agreement.

A delegation from the Pembroke local council made up of mayor Joe Zammit, councillor Alfred Mazzitelli and councillor Evelyn Vella Brincat recently went to Roccalumera to meet the town's mayor Giovanni Miasi and councillors.

The two sides discussed the similarities between the two towns and the pros and cons of twinning. Youth exchanges, tourism, language studies and cultural visits were also the focus of the visit.

Mr Zammit and Mr Miasi signed a Letter of Intent to Twin at the council's conference room.
